Benutzer:PerfektesChaos/js/userspaceLinks

aus Wikipedia, der freien Enzyklopädie
Zur Navigation springen Zur Suche springen

JavaScript Gadget – um Sonderfunktionen bereitzustellen, die auf einzelne Benutzer bezogen sind.

Zurzeit ist dies nur ein Link auf Unterseiten; später sollen Werkzeuge der neuen labsconsole: folgen. Anregungen sind willkommen.

Einbindung[Bearbeiten | Quelltext bearbeiten]

  • Wenn das Projekt dieses Gadget bereits registriert haben sollte, genügt ein Häkchen auf der Seite Einstellungen („Helferlein“).
  • Sonst wären die folgenden Zeilen in die persönlichen JS-Einstellungen einzufügen:
mw.loader.load("//www.mediawiki.org/w/index.php?title=User:PerfektesChaos/js/userspaceLinks/r.js&action=raw&bcache=1&maxage=604800&ctype=text/javascript",
               "text/javascript");
  • Das Gadget funktioniert auch mit Nicht-WMF-Projekten, sofern diese MediaWiki ab 1.18 verwenden. Eigene Icons können definiert werden.
  • Beachte: Wenn du Blockier-Software (wie NoScript) verwenden solltest, müsstest du ggf. mediawiki.org freigeben; siehe hier.

Wirkung[Bearbeiten | Quelltext bearbeiten]

Auf einzelne Benutzer bezogen sind folgende Seiten:

Unterseiten[Bearbeiten | Quelltext bearbeiten]

Ein Link wird zur Werkzeugbox (üblicherweise linke Spalte der Portalseite) hinzugefügt. Es öffnet eine Liste aller Unterseiten dieses Benutzers.

Wenn aus einer Unterseite heraus aufgerufen wird, werden nur diese Seite und deren Unterseiten aufgelistet.

Spezial:Präfixindex ist hier das Ziel und kann nicht sich selbst aufrufen.

Codes und Stammseite[Bearbeiten | Quelltext bearbeiten]

Die Stammseite ist mw:User:PerfektesChaos/js/userspaceLinks mit:

Quellcode
ResourceLoader
Namensräume -1, 2, 3
mw.libs userspaceLinks